Manchester Township, New Jersey is known for its rural atmosphere and its proximity to the Jersey Shore. The Manchester Township City Council is composed of five members, each elected to a three-year term. The Council meets on the first and third Tuesday of each month at 7:00 p.m. in the Council Chambers at 1 Colonial Drive.
